Driver

We offer competitive salary, full benefits package, Paid Time Off, and opportunities for professional growth.

Pinnacle Treatment Centers is a growing leader in addiction treatment services. We provide care across the nation touching the lives of 30,000 patients daily. We are on a mission to remove all barriers to recovery and transform individual, families, and communities with treatment that works. Our employees believe we are creating a better world where lives and communities are made whole again through comprehensive treatment.

As a Driver, you will be primarily responsible for transporting patients to and from treatment. You must be able to interact with patients and staff in a professional manner and maintain safe driving record.

Requirements:

  • High school diploma/GED or verifiable work experience in lieu of education  
  • One (1) year patient transport service experience 
  • CPR (Cardiopulmonary resuscitation), First Aid, and BLS (Basic Life Support) certification.  
  • Must possess a current valid driver’s license in good standing 
  • Localized travel up to 75% is required. 

Preferred 

  • Three (3) years patient transport service experience 
  • Experience working in substance use and/or mental health field. 

Responsibilities:

  • Daily communication with Admissions Manager on any transportation issues or concerns.
  • Transport patients, paperwork, and patient belongings during admissions, dismissals, and transfers to and from each facility in our 15-passenger vans.
  • Transport clients to meetings, other facilities, and appointments whenever necessary.
  • Pick up new clients.
  • Responsible for pick-up and delivery of all interoffice mail at all locations.
  • Performs maintenance of all vehicles (oil changes, tire pressure, inspections, etc.)
  • Completes transportation log daily and maintenance logs when necessary.
  • Responsible for the verification/completion of Transport Payment Form (client approval/signature)

Benefits: (available to PT and FT employees only; PRN employees will be offered limited benefits)

  • 18 days PTO (Paid Time Off)
  • 401k with company match
  • Company sponsored ongoing training and certification opportunities.
  • Full comprehensive benefits package including medical, dental, vision, short term disability, long term disability and accident insurance.
  • Substance Use Disorder Treatment and Recovery Loan Repayment Program (STAR LRP)
  • Discounted tuition and scholarships through Capella University
